We prioritise according to the severity of the disease

If several children need support at the same time, we first carry out an immediate initial assessment and prioritise treatment according to the severity of the illness. Our aim is to ensure that every child receives the best possible care. Therefore, we do not follow the order of arrival, but follow an established emergency concept.
